What companies run services between Porto, Portugal and Moscow, Russia?

Royal Air Maroc, Air Serbia, and three other airlines fly from Francisco De Sá Carneiro Airport (OPO) to Sheremetyevo International Airport (SVO) once daily.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Porto - Hospital de São João to Moscow Novoyasnevskaya via Paris Porte Maillot, Paris, Berlin, Zentralen Omnibusbahnhof, and Minsk Central Bus Station in around 2d 18h.
